Are You Afraid of the Bark?

Episode 5: British Ghost Cats

Michelle Anne Olsen Season 1 Episode 5
Pour yourself a cup of tea and settle-in for Episode 5 of Are You Afraid of the Bark?, chock-full of tales of British ghost cats, and even a well-perpetuated conspiracy that alien big cats might roam the British countryside!